Hugely dissapointing because I'm originally from Serbia..

This is not the team and skill Serbia showed in qualifications.. it was awful play.

Ghana fully deserved it.

You only saw a glimpse of how good Serbia could play when they lost 1 player. They started coming back and playing as they should and then bad luck with the penalty.

But I don't get why the hell the coach obviously told them to play it safe and almost play to just hold the tie.. the worst type of thing you could do.. If they attacked from the start like they can, they would've beat Ghana 3:0 or something.. but they held back, let Ghana attack and finally lost by that freakin' penalty.

Serves them right. I'm glad for Ghana.. they played offensively and were trying super hard and were rewarded with a win.

Interestingly enough Ghana coach is from Serbia too :) That's probably why he knew how Serbian team would play for the most part.

Overall very disappointing game for Serbia. They might as well pack their suitcases as they'll lose from Germany without a doubt and that's it.

    • Go on, I'll bite. How does windows (nice comment on an 'article' which doesn't actually involve it ) lock users out of their data then? Been using it since 3.1 back in 92 and not once have I been locked out of my data? Perhaps you mean Bitlocker? In which case the average user (who doesn't mess about) will have been forced to use a MSA, and in which case the recovery key would have been saved to said account..... If the user did happen to bodge around and not use an MSA then Bitlocker wouldn't have become live (as it cannot without a safe place to store the key) I want to point out Bitlocker and MSA are not connected and you can of course force it on without a safe place to store the key, but you do that with your eyes open. So your standard consumer who knows no better sets up an MSA, gets bitlocker and a recovery key stored off box, with a route to reset their password. All of this notwithstanding the fact, if your data is important, you back it up, no ifs, no buts, no-ones responsibility other than your own. Important data lives in at least two locations, one of which is offline and recovery is tested, otherwise that data wasn't really that important. Disks, fail, laptops get lost, phones end up down the toilet, tablets get stolen, if your only copy of data is on a single device you're doing it wrong.
